(1) Pick up version file from /var/db if it exists there. I will
commit a change to actually move the file in a couple of days. (Right now this file looks at both /var/db and /var/db/pkg.) Requested by: jkh (2) Skip version test for 2.2.x, I don't intend to rebuild update kits anymore. (3) sunsite.unc.edu -> metalab.unc.edu Submitted by: steve (4) New variable ALWAYS_BUILD_DEPENDS, it will make your build go and rebuild all dependencies (except XFree86) regardless of executable/file/shlib test results. It could be useful if you suspect that some of the dependencies are out of date but won't be flagged by the normal checks. Reviewed by: the ports list
